Q. What is signifying when it is said that beings of the phylum Annelida are vascular beings? From which other phyla of the animal kingdom does this feature differentiate them?
The classification of these beings as vascular beings means that they have a circulatory system, with vessels that distribute substances all through the body.
Poriferans, cnidarians and flatworms do not have a circulatory system. In nematodes there is circulation of nutrients and gases through the pseudocoelom fluid.
